Painted Lady: Marion Cotillard Is A Work Of Art In Dior's Latest Campaign
comments
The striking image — photographed by Tim Walker — is a blaze of cobalt blue and crisp, bright white. It appears to have been shot in a gallery with Cotillard posing as the work of art. This marks five years of Dior campaigns for the Inception actress, and it's definitely one of our favorite looks.
Cotillard pairs a dress from the resort 2014 collection with a matching paint-box Lady Dior bag — a classic that has impressive details and requires eight — yes, eight — hours of craftsmanship. The bag’s distinctive pattern was inspired by the Napoleon III couture chairs from the first Christian Dior show in 1947, not to mention the carryall was favored by Princess Di.
